Ecology of Acanthurus sohal
 
Main Ref. Sommer, C., W. Schneider and J.-M. Poutiers, 1996
Remarks Diurnally feeding species; spawns at new moon shortly after sunrise (Refs. 120973, 202, 9773). Dwells in coral reef areas and shallow waters. Forms large feeding aggregations to graze on algae (Refs. 9773, 129713 ).

Feeding

Feeding type mainly plants/detritus (troph. 2-2.19)
Feeding type Ref. Sommer, C., W. Schneider and J.-M. Poutiers, 1996
Feeding habit grazing on aquatic plants
